Sally Spencer's Memorial Plaque


It was a special occasion on Saturday 1st June, as we gathered to unveil the memorial plaque for our dear, former Membership Secretary Sally Spencer, who sadly passed away last year.  Sally was a much loved part of life at St.Saviour's church, as well as being part of our Friends Committee.
She will always be remembered as a warm and welcoming soul, frequently found offering tea, coffee and cakes, with an encouraging smile.

We are very grateful to  Phil Stafford  of Revive Stone Walls , who set the plaque, which we had purchased,  in the wall by our double rose arch. Phil kindly did this free of charge.
It was lovely to have so many of Sally's friends there for the unveiling, as well as one of Sally's sons Andrew Spencer.

 Our new Membership Secretary Linda Atkinson had bought a beautiful rose called Simply Sally which she planted beside the wall plaque. 


Thanks also to our President Patricia Williams, who gave a short address to those gathered.  The unveiling was followed by refreshments.
